Hi!
If I have one layer containing different kinds of objects in different colour, is there any way I can select all those of one color? For example, I have houses in magenta and roads in white but in the same layer. If I mark a house and use Select Similar the entire layer will get selected although I just want to select the houses. Can I do a selection based on the colour they have?
